Output 377916f31005c4cb310784bd4b0ff53f783d9a6d58130226f4036a0345702aa7:0

value
28262700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6026b3fc350b6ab517d058de719eec67d749f33a OP_EQUALVERIFY OP_CHECKSIG
address
19mQEZ1paF8TJy58aMPVPZ7CbZ6Lrnz6xE
transaction
377916f31005c4cb310784bd4b0ff53f783d9a6d58130226f4036a0345702aa7
spent
true